  • MRI Technologist

    University of Virginia (Charlottesville, VA)



    Apply Now

    Responsible for performing routine to complex diagnostic and therapeutic technical procedures in the MRI department under the direction of a physician.

     

    + Performs quality assurance checks on equipment and procedure areas.

    + Ensures proper safety standards are met.

    + Operates required equipment necessary to produce scans using established guidelines and MRI protocols.

    + Properly identifies and explains procedure to patient.

    + Starts IV access according to standard procedure and injects media under the direction of a physician.

    + Prepares and positions patient for procedure by using established MRI protocols to achieve the highest quality image.

    + Instructs students and residents and performs preceptor duties when necessary.

    + Assists in maintaining supply inventory.

    + In addition to the above job responsibilities, other duties may be assigned.

    MINIMUM REQUIREMENTS

    Education:

    • Experienced candidate(s) should have completed MRI training/competency via the American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T) or the American Registry of Magnetic Resonance Imaging Technologists (ARMRIT).

    • Inexperienced candidate(s) at a minimum, must be certified in Radiography, Nuclear Medicine, Radiation Therapy, Sonography, or Vascular Sonography.

    • Associate’s Degree preferred, but not required.

    **Experience:** MRI experience preferred but not required.

    Licensure:

    • Experienced candidate(s) must be registered by the American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T) or the American Registry of Magnetic Resonance Imaging Technologists (ARMRIT).

    • Inexperienced candidate(s) must be registered in X-Ray, Ultrasound, Nuclear Medicine, or Radiation Therapy by one or more of the following agencies: “ARRT - The American Registry of Radiologic Technologists; ARDMS – The American Registry of Diagnostic Medical Sonographers, or NMTCB – The Nuclear Medicine Technology Certification Board.”

    • MRI Certification via the ARRT or ARMRIT must be successfully completed within 9 months of hire.

    • American Heart Association (AHA) Healthcare Provider BLS certification required.

    PHYSICAL DEMANDS

    Job requires standing for prolonged periods, frequently bending/stooping, reaching (overhead, extensive, and repetitive); Repetitive motion: computer keyboard. Proficient communicative, auditory and visual skills; Attention to detail and ability to write legibly; Ability to lift/push/pull 50 - 100lbs. May be exposed to, cold, dust, noise, radiation, blood/body fluids and infectious disease.
